Abstract: A set of documents associated with a query comprising one or more query terms is determined. A subset of the documents is sampled to identify a corresponding query constraint pattern associated with each document included in the subset of the documents. An entry of an inverted index is generated based on the corresponding query constraint pattern associated with each document included in the subset of document.
Abstract: A binary that is stored in a portion of runtime memory subject to garbage collection is analyzed. An amount of memory in a portion of runtime memory not subject to garbage collection is allocated for a binary copy based on the analysis. The binary is copied to the allocated portion of runtime memory not subject to garbage collection.
Abstract: A plurality of documents are determined to have a same representation. One of the plurality of documents is selected to be a parent document. A row of a database associated with the selected parent document is updated. The row of the database associated with the selected parent document is updated to include information associated with the plurality of documents having the same representation.
